Bisecting k means c++
Web#Shorts #bisectingkmeans #aiBisecting K-Means Clustering technique is similar to the regular K-means clustering algorithm but with some minor differences. In... WebBisectingKMeans. ¶. A bisecting k-means algorithm based on the paper “A comparison of document clustering techniques” by Steinbach, Karypis, and Kumar, with modification to fit Spark. The algorithm starts from a single cluster that contains all points. Iteratively it finds divisible clusters on the bottom level and bisects each of them ...
Bisecting k means c++
Did you know?
WebK-means聚类实现流程 事先确定常数K,常数K意味着最终的聚类类别数; 随机选定初始点为质⼼,并通过计算每⼀个样本与质⼼之间的相似度(这⾥为欧式距离),将样本点归到最相似 的类中, WebJun 24,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ams
WebJan 23, 2024 · Bisecting K-means clustering technique is a little modification to the regular K-Means algorithm, wherein you fix the way you go about dividing data into clusters. So, similar to K-means we first ... WebMar 17, 2024 · Bisecting k-means is more efficient when K is large. For the kmeans algorithm, the computation involves every data point of the data set and k centroids. On …
WebJun 16, 2024 · Modified Image from Source. B isecting K-means clustering technique is a little modification to the regular K-Means algorithm, wherein you fix the procedure of dividing the data into clusters. So, similar to K … WebThis example shows differences between Regular K-Means algorithm and Bisecting K-Means. While K-Means clusterings are different when increasing n_clusters, Bisecting …
WebThe algorithm starts from a single cluster that contains all points. Iteratively it finds divisible clusters on the bottom level and bisects each of them using k-means, until there are k …
WebMay 19, 2024 · Here is an example using the four-dimensional "Iris" dataset of 150 observations with two k-means clusters. First, the cluster centers (heavily rounded): Sepal Length Sepal Width Petal Length Petal Width 1 6 3 5 2.0 2 5 3 2 0.3 Next, their (rounded) Z-scores. These are defined, as usual, as the difference between a coordinate and the … optus sport foxtelWebQuestion: Implementing bisecting k-means clustering algorithm in C++, that randomly generated two dimensional real valued data points in a square 1.0 <=c, y<= 100.0. Show result for two in separate cases k=2 and k =4. Then show the effect of using two different measures ( Euclidean and Manhattan). portsmouth city council hrWebApr 18, 2024 · K-Means and Bisecting K-Means clustering algorithms implemented in Python 3. - GitHub - gbroques/k-means: K-Means and Bisecting K-Means clustering … portsmouth city council homelessnessWebJan 20, 2024 · Specifically, pyspark.ml.clustering.BisectingKMeansModel exposes a .save (path) method. from pyspark.ml.clustering import BisectingKMeans k=30 bkm = BisectingKMeans (k=k, minDivisibleClusterSize=1.0) bkm.setMaxIter (10) model = bkm.fit (examples) model.save ("path/to/saved_model") Now separately, in Python, I use … optus sport for windows 10WebDec 10, 2024 · Implementation of K-means and bisecting K-means method in Python The implementation of K-means method based on the example from the book "Machine … portsmouth city council intranetWebNov 28, 2024 · Bisecting k-means algorithm implementation (text clustering) Implement the bisecting k-Means clustering algorithm for clustering text data. Input data (provided as … optus sport loginWebJul 19, 2024 · Bisecting K-means is a clustering method; it is similar to the regular K-means but with some differences. In Bisecting K-means we initialize the centroids randomly or by using other methods; then we iteratively perform a regular K-means on the data with the number of clusters set to only two (bisecting the data). portsmouth city council meetings live